Strategic Growth Through Partnerships and Innovation
ABB’s collaboration with Microsoft Azure underpins its cloud-based offerings, while investments in start‑ups fuel innovation in industrial AI. The company’s decentralized model fosters agility, focusing on electrification, automation, and sustainability aligned with global megatrends.
